c# (vs2015)textbox控件参数txt格式文件保存与读取

 ` public Form1()
    {
        InitializeComponent();
        //设置参数文件路径及文件名(在项目文件中)
        string CurDir = System.AppDomain.CurrentDomain.BaseDirectory + @"SaveDir\";//设置当前目录
       //该路径不存在时,在当前文件目录下创建文件夹"
        if (!System.IO.Directory.Exists(CurDir)) System.IO.Directory.CreateDirectory(CurDir);               _filePath = CurDir + "曝光等数据表.txt";
        _filePath = CurDir + "相机参数表.txt";
        ReadFile();//先设置一个再自动读取
    }`
//保存参数文件
        string _filePath;
        public void SaveFile()
        {
            using (StreamWriter sw = new StreamWriter(_filePath, false, Encoding.Default))
            {
                sw.Write("采集帧率" + "=" + tbFrameRate.Text + "\r\n");
                sw.Write("曝光时间" + "=" + tbExposure.Text + "\r\n");
                sw.Write("增益" + "=" + tbGain.Text + "\r\n");
            }
  //读取保存文件
        public void ReadFile()
        {
            string[] nLines = File.ReadAllLines(_filePath, Encoding.Default);
            char[] chs = { '=' };
            string[] text0 = nLines[0].Split(chs, StringSplitOptions.RemoveEmptyEntries);
            tbFrameRate.Text = text0[1];
            string[] text1 = nLines[1].Split(chs, StringSplitOptions.RemoveEmptyEntries);
            tbExposure.Text = text1[1];
            string[] text2 = nLines[2].Split(chs, StringSplitOptions.RemoveEmptyEntries);
            tbGain.Text = text2[1];
        }

在这里插入图片描述

  • 0
    点赞
  • 10
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值